Comparing Iran with Brooklyn Park, Minnesota

Compare Climate information for Iran and Brooklyn Park, Minnesota

Is Iran warmer or hotter than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ota?

On average across the year, yes, Iran is hotter than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ota . Iran has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F and Brooklyn Park, Minnesota has an average temperature of 8°C/46°F.

Iran's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 37°C/99°F, which is hotter than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).

Is Iran colder or cooler than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ota?

On average across the year, no, Iran is not colder than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ota . Iran has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F and Brooklyn Park, Minnesota has an average minimum temperature of 3°C/37°F.



Iran's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of -1°C/30°F, which is not colder than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ota's coldest month (also January, with an average minimum temperature of -13°C/9°F).

Does Iran have more rain than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ota?

On average across the year, no, Iran has less rain than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ota. Iran has an average annual rainfall of 232mm and Brooklyn Park, Minnesota has an average annual rainfall of 727mm.

Iran's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 38mm, which is drier than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ota's wettest month (May, with an average monthly rainfall of 122mm).
